There is a "Components" keyword in /etc/freebsd-update.conf. If you remove the word kernel there, your kernel should stay untouched during the update. Not sure if that is what you are looking for though.

Hi,

freebsd-update will overwrite /boot/kernel and save old kernel to /boot/kernel.old.
You can install your custom kernel in other destination so that freebsd-update don't mess with it:
Code:
make kernel KERNCONF=MYKERNEL KODIR=/boot/MYKERNEL
and test onerun to check if kernel is ok:
Code:
nextboot -k /boot/MYKERNEL
reboot
make it permanent:
/boot/loader.conf:
Code:
kernel="MYKERNEL"
kernels="MYKERNEL.old kernel kernel.old"

freebsd-update is mostly a tool that downloads big packages of files, and then places files in the places they belong. For example, it knows that when a new kernel needs to be installed, it needs to overwrite /boot/kernel/if_xyz.ko. What do you expect that tool to do if you have modified those files locally? Leave them alone silently? That would be insane, because asked the tool to perform an update. Give you an error message and completely stop working? That would be insane too, because then it would become impossible to fix a system that has been accidentally slightly damaged. Print warning messages? Maybe it does that, maybe it doesn't, I haven't looked. I know that it does some tricks to merge configuration files that are expected to be edited (such as /etc/rc.conf), but I fully expect it to install the upgraded files.

If you want to run a local private kernel, and make sure it doesn't get upgraded to the release version when you ask freebsd-update to install the release version, you'll have to store it in a different place.
